What happens during a match and how the price moves
Video reaches the viewer a few seconds behind the data traders work from, so the number has already moved by the time the picture shows the action. Traders watch the same feed you do, a few seconds ahead of the screen in front of you. A trailing side pushing its defenders forward leaves space behind, so the next-goal market tightens in its favour while quietly getting more generous for the team countering. How far the number travels depends on when the incident lands and on what the score was before it.
Added time is worked out from what has actually happened: goals, celebrations and substitutions stretch it, so a match already full of goals hands out a few more minutes for one more. Totals bought before kick-off often come in through that door rather than through open football. The wording states whether cards shown to substitutes, to staff or after the final whistle enter the count, and settlement follows that text to the letter. Goal markets and discipline markets pull in opposite directions more often than newcomers expect them to.
with an open finish, last goalscorer adds a thrill A referee who reaches for his pocket early sets the tone for the rest of the evening. The interval is the only point where the whole second period is available with the first one already known, shapes seen and the balance of the game established. Halved totals therefore look mispriced at the interval and very rarely are.
Some teams treat long throws exactly like corners: the same bodies pile into the box and a whole defence has to reorganise for a restart nobody prepared for. A corner count that keeps climbing shows the pressure behind the scoreline is real. Pulling off a booked player is a standard precaution around the hour mark, and the cards market loses one of its likeliest candidates on the spot. Read the bench before touching a next-goal price, because the change usually arrives before the goal does.
When a statistical edge is wide yet nothing moves on the board, it usually points to a well-organised defence rather than a collapse waiting to happen on the other side. Territory and shots on target tell two different stories, and only one of them reaches the result. Video always reaches your screen later than data reaches the trading desk, so a suspension can begin several moments before you actually see what caused it. The wait lasts seconds, and the figure that comes back afterwards is the honest one.
What to check before backing a Ukraine. Premier League side
When qualification runs over two meetings, the result carried out of the first one sets the attitude of the second: one camp defends a capital, the other has no option left but to attack. Late in a campaign the standing tells you what each club still needs, and that need shapes an evening more than any tactical plan. Defeats can mislead. A camp beaten in the decisive moments without ever being outplayed usually sits far closer to a turnaround than its position suggests. A run assembled against the bottom of the table is worth less than one draw taken away to the leaders.
Muscle problems multiply through crowded weeks, and a withdrawal during the warm-up can rewrite the team sheet shortly before kick-off. Rotation is announced late, so team news an hour before kick-off is worth more than a week of previews. The official sheet published shortly before the start redraws the prices: a suspension served, a return from injury or a key name rested moves the line within minutes. The only way to settle the question is to look at how home sides have actually fared in this particular competition.
A trip into a very different climate weighs more than the mileage does, because heat, humidity or altitude change how a team breathes before they change how it plays. Travel widens that gap when a visiting squad crosses the country the day before. A poor surface suits whoever plays simple and defends in numbers, while the side that insists on building from the back loses possession in areas it would never choose. Heat and heavy rain both drag totals downwards, though they arrive at that result by different routes.
A busy goalkeeper is bad news for the defence in front of him even while his team leads, because the save count measures the pressure absorbed over the spell just played. Numbers help once you know which of them the game actually turned on. A shot count lumps together blocked efforts from range and chances taken close in. Without knowing where they came from, the total describes two completely different matches. Shots on target and touches in the opposition box survive that test far better than a possession percentage does.
Statistics pooled across cup and league throw together opponents from different levels and produce an average that describes neither competition. A famous name stays in the price long after it has stopped being earned on the pitch. Centre-back partnerships are built over months of small habits. Two defenders who have never started together step up half a beat apart, and that gap is exactly what a through ball needs. A late change between the posts is the team-news item most previews skip entirely. Depth is measured in goal as well: a reserve keeper rarely plays, and the gap with the first choice shows faster there than anywhere else on the pitch. Thin squads swing hardest when a suspension and an injury land in the same week.
